r ACCOUNTANCY PARTNERSHIP Age from mid -20 s Exceiient Professional and Income Prospects We have been asked to assist in the identification of a Chartered Accountant to join a long established, successful South Island provincial town practice with early opportunity for partnership. The position would suit a qualified person of 25-40 years of age with a broad range of experience. It is preferable that this experience should have been obtained from a professional office. The rewards, remuneration and working conditions are excellent and only those candidates wishing eventually to earn in excess of $70,000 p.a. should apply. Although not essential it is desirable that the appointee would be available to commence around October or November this year.
